Kim Gu-ra reveals secret to comedian Kim Jeong-ryeol's real estate wealth

Broadcaster Kim Gu-ra advises comedian Lee Sun-min on the importance of investment, citing veteran Kim Jeong-ryeol's frugal habits and real estate success.

Broadcaster Kim Gu-ra emphasized the importance of investment to junior comedian Lee Sun-min, sharing the financial success story of veteran comedian Kim Jeong-ryeol. The anecdote describes how Kim, who has had limited broadcasting activity for a long time, accumulated significant assets through real estate investment driven by frugal spending habits.

On the 15th, Kim discussed real estate and wealth management with Lee in a video uploaded to his YouTube channel 'Grigura.' The video was titled 'Can Lee Sun-min's house price, which is inversely proportional to his popularity, be saved?'

During the session, Kim noted that the income structure for comedians has changed significantly compared to the past, observing that it is no longer easy to establish a stable economic foundation solely through entertainment activities.

"Since the structure for making huge amounts of money no longer exists, investment is crucial," he said. "There is a massive difference in wealth later on between those who take an interest in investment early and those who have a mindset of 'I'll just keep working, I'm an artist.'"

He cited Kim Jeong-ryeol as a representative example.

"He hasn't been active for a long time, but he has had frugal spending habits since way back," Kim explained. "He had a building in Kangnam a long time ago, and by moving buildings a few times, he became an immense real estate tycoon."

Kim Jeong-ryeol is a veteran comedian who debuted through the 1981 MBC Gag Contest and gained widespread popularity with catchphrases such as 'Sunguri Dangdang.' Although he has not appeared on broadcasts frequently since his heyday, Kim noted that his long-term wealth management habits led to significant asset formation.

In particular, Kim shared an anecdote about how Kim Jeong-ryeol extremely minimized his spending even while traveling for external events in the past.

"When he was doing night work (events), he saved so much by only eating moon bread and milk, and he became incredibly wealthy by buying land with that money," he said. Rather than spending most of his income on living expenses, he consistently invested in land and real estate.

Kim further emphasized Kim Jeong-ryeol's successful wealth management, adding, "He was so successful that colleagues even said he has more money than his contemporary senior Lee Kyung-kyu."

The story draws attention because it highlights that it is difficult to judge a celebrity's economic success based solely on their current activity level or public recognition. Kim specifically advised Lee that since it is impossible to know how long income from broadcasting will last, he must manage his assets and take an interest in investment during his active years.

Ultimately, Kim emphasized not merely the success of real estate investment, but the importance of balancing consumption and asset formation when income is generated. Since Kim Jeong-ryeol's case resulted from a combination of frugal habits and shifts in the real estate market, it serves as a case study in long-term asset management rather than a direct formula for the current investment environment.

Kim repeatedly emphasized to Lee that while a celebrity's popularity can change at any time, consistent asset management and interest in investment can serve as a realistic foundation to prepare for periods of inactivity.
